The TIP process will provide you with a thorough in-depth analysis of your STAAR performance. This thorough in-depth analysis will provide a look at STAAR performance by district, campus, teacher, and/or student. For both current year and historically. You can now use these findings to create a framework for Scope & Sequence, instruction and assessment decisions for the next school year.

Learn the most effective ways to utilize Aware to determine your intervention groups, content reteach, and analyze growth.
Below are some of the areas that will be covered in the STEP Analysis Process.
Step 1 - Find Your Lowest Performing SEs
Step 2 - Analyze SE's by Test Question
Step 3 - Monitor SE Performance by Teacher
Step 4a - Find Students Not Passing
Step 4b - Find Students Scoring 50 to 70
Step 5 - Analyze/Group Students by SE
Step 6 - Analyze SE's by Test Question for Students Scoring > 70
